Alive In Wild Paint robbed on the road

Adding another victim to the seemingly growing list of bands getting robbed on tour, Alive In Wild Paint have had their trailer stolen. According to their blog:



Unless someone is playing a practical joke on us, our trailer has been stolen. Inside the trailer was an original UK Vox AC30 6TB 2×12 combo, a roadcase for that combo, a ridiculously large drum roadcase, an iPod, clothing, merchandise, many many many CD’s, etc. All of this is gone along with the trailer.



If you see a white dual axle 6×12 Pace American trailer without fenders and spray paint on one side that is somewhat removed … pull the driver out of the vehicle, knock him out, lock him in one of the roadcases (preferably the smaller one), lock up the trailer, and leave him. Then call the police and let them know where they can find him.



If you are reading this and steal things to make a living, PLEASE get a job like the rest of us. I’m sure you are a big boy and can handle it.



Matt



The Phoenix, Arizona rock quartet was out in support of their Equal Vision debut, Ceilings.
